Kroger spent millions advertising its own peanut butter—why?

This year’s AFC Championship Game had everything—Joe Cool, a hold-your-chest, game-winning field goal, and…Kroger-brand peanut butter?

Discussion Questions:

  1. What is a brand?
  2. What is branding?
  3. What are the different types of brands?
  4. What is a private label brand?
  5. Why are private label brands important to a company like Kroger?
  6. According to this story, how much private label brand peanut butter did Kroger sell last year?
  7. What is pricing?
  8. How do private label brands typically compare to corporate or product brands from a price perspective?
  9. What is advertising?
  10. Why do businesses and brands advertise?
  11. What is inflation?
  12. How does inflation typically impact consumer behavior?
  13. How might that explain why sales of private label brands are on the rise?
  14. How might that explain Kroger’s decision to invest millions in advertising its private label brands?
